I've used the attached "script", which is also in userapps/lsc/h1/scripts/DARM_transitions, to transition DARM control from the ETMX ESD to ITMX, leaving the upper stage control on EX.
The attached screenshot shows the DARM OLG in the normal configuration (EX bias 130V, drivealign gain 184.65) and in the current configuration (IX bias -428V drivealign gain -108.4V).
Robert did a ground injection while sweeping the EX bias.
I then switched the ESD bias back to -125V, and started to switch the DARM control back to EX starting with the settings in 66751. This matched the DARM gain pretty well, with a discrepancy in the OLG measured at 200 Hz of .15%. I didn't have time to do a broadband pcal measurement before we lost lock, but this should have kept the calibration OK.
